Thomas O'Connor, Vice President
Thomas was born and educated in New York. He has also lived in Atlanta, Houston, West Palm Beach, and Las Vegas. His job as Vice-President of Sales for a Molecular Diagnostics company relocated him in 2006 to the great city of Austin.  He ran competitively in high school, but dropped it to focus on his education and career.  It wasn’t until 2004 that he set his sights on completing a marathon. He had to challenge his North American sales team with a task (doubling their annual quotas when a 10% increase was the norm) that they thought would be simply too large to accomplish.  He gave a speech of “Believe and Achieve” on being able to accomplish things far greater than one thinks they can by setting clear goals, creating a plan and executing. During this talk the team challenged him to do something equally as difficult. The task he agreed to would be complete a marathon.  At 40-years old, and weighing about 205 pounds, and having not run a single step in God knows how long, he accepted the challenge.  Both the team and Thomas achieved success in reaching their goals. Thomas is now about 150 pounds, running 60 to 70 miles most weeks, and is training to break 3 hours at Boston in April of 2008.
 Thomas joined the Twenty-Six Two Marathon Club shortly after relocating to Austin in 2006.  Thomas quotes, “My running has inspired a belief in me that I can achieve things that others can only dream of. When I set my goals, build a well designed plan and take it one step at a time, I can make great things happen in all areas of my life.”
